Atrium
A chamber of the heart that receives blood returning to the heart from the body or the lungs.
Ventricle
(1) One of four interconnected chambers in the brain through which cerebrospinal fluid flows. (2) One of the chambers of the heart that receives blood from an atrium and pumps blood into arteries.
Pacemaker
An artificial device implanted in the body which uses electrical impulses to regulate the heart's rhythm or reproduce that rhythm.
Atrioventricular Node
A part of the heart's electrical system which regulates the timing of the heartbeats by delaying the transmission of electrical impulses from the atria to the ventricles.
